Batterieladegeräte

Batterielade-ICs sind Power-Management-Bausteine zur Steuerung von Ladestrom, Ladespannung, Schutzfunktionen und Ladeabschluss für wiederaufladbare Batterien. Sie werden häufig mit Lithium-Ionen-, Lithium-Polymer-, NiMH- und anderen Batteriechemien in tragbaren Elektronikgeräten, Elektrowerkzeugen, Medizintechnik, Industrieanlagen, Kommunikationsprodukten, Fahrzeugsystemen und batteriebetriebenen eingebetteten Anwendungen eingesetzt.
